top of page

Are you an A+ Series startup?     Get first talent FREE OF CHARGE!     Check if you qualify →

 

Hire as Freelancer

37 €

/hour

Not available

or

Hire as Employee

3400 €

/month

$

TALENT-25592

Gegham

Node.js Developer

Armenia

Seniority

Senior

Language skills

English B2

Hire employees directly using our Employer Of Record & Payroll tool:
- Recruitment fee, talent's one month salary
- EOR €199/month

Skills

docker iot javascript mongodb mqtt node.js rejected mail to be sent typescript

Industry

IT Services and IT Consulting

Professional Summary

Candidate brings a robust and diverse skill set, with a primary focus on Node.js development spanning an impressive 6 years. During this extensive period, they have honed their expertise in crafting scalable and efficient server-side applications using Node.js. This substantial experience underscores their in-depth understanding of JavaScript and its application in server-side scripting. Complementing their Node.js proficiency, the candidate boasts 4 years of experience with TypeScript, showcasing their commitment to utilizing statically typed languages for enhanced code quality and maintainability. In the realm of Internet of Things (IoT) and messaging protocols, this candidate has accrued 2 years of experience with MQTT. Furthermore, their 1-year experience with Nest.js, a popular Node.js framework, reflects their adaptability to modern web development practices. The candidate's proficiency in Linux for 5 years attests to their comfort with open-source environments and their ability to navigate and optimize software solutions in a variety of Linux-based systems. Finally, their involvement in several projects utilizing WebSockets underscores their ability to implement real-time, bidirectional communication between clients and servers.

Video of Talent

Portfolio

Education

National Polytechnic University of Armenia / Master's degree, Information Technology

Sep 2020 - Jan 2023


National Polytechnic University of Armenia / Bachelor's degree, Electrical and Electronics Engineering

Sep 2017 - Jun 2020

Certifications and Trainings

Experience

Node.js, Back-end Developer / Studio-one

Dec 2018 - Present

Yerevan


  • Designing and implementing scalable back-end solutions using Node JS, collaborating with the team to deliver high-quality software.

  • Experience in building RESTful APIs, implementing database designs, and ensuring overall performance and security of web applications

  • Leading a team of developers, providing mentorship, and ensuring the team's success in meeting project deadlines.

  • Skills in agile development methodologies, test-driven development, and code optimization.

  • Conducted code reviews, ensuring best practices and coding standards are followed.

  • Proud to have been part of a team that delivered high-quality software solutions to clients.




Back-end Node.js Developer / One labs

Aug 2017 - Dec 2018

Yerevan


  • Solid understanding of web development fundamentals including HTML, CSS, and JavaScript.

  • Proficiency in Node.js and experience with popular frameworks such as Express.js.

  • Knowledge of database technologies like MongoDB or MySQL.

  • Excellent communication and teamwork skills to collaborate effectively with the development team and stakeholders

  • Self-motivated and eager to learn and adapt to new technologies and industry trends.



Projects:


Uni-ticket


Website which sales airline tickets. It has CMS for clients, that can manage and add some information.


  • Technologies Used: Javascript, REST, MongoDB



ZCMC


Web application revolutionizes mining operations by automating processes and collecting valuable data. With the ability to parse data from Teltonika devices, it streamlines operations, improves efficiency, enhances safety, and offers advanced data analysis tools.


  • Technologies Used: C, PHP, Javascript, REST, socket, MySQL, Teltonika, CRC Calculation



Megazen


Platform for blog news. Media people and bloggers share their stories and blog posts by categories. It has ability to parse news from other news portals and create blog posts. Users select their favorite categories and read blog posts.



Bet&Mix


Api for betting companies, which mixes real games and create virtual ones. Any betting company can integrate and use as betting system.


  • Technologies Used: Typescript, REST, Rabbitmq, Postgresql, Clickhouse, docker



CMS generator


Allow to generate back end from templates (models, controllers, APIs, modules) and CMS(Vue is). Several generators create new project, template with codes for common files and automate your development.


  • Technologies Used: Typescript, javascript.



Unimacs


Access system control. This system get information from client who register cardholders who can access and control doors, gates. Information saved on hardware. Client can see all the statuses and events in real time.


  • Technologies Used: Typescript, REST, mqtt, Clickhouse, docker, MySQL.



Haypost


Website, that includes parcel tracking system, parcel calculators, money transfer calculator, job application forms.


  • Technologies Used: Typescript, REST, docker, PostgreSQL.



Casino and betting Plaform


Casino project that has functionality to have several websites and platform, there exists lot of microservices with high architecture solution with high responsibility.


  • Technologies Used: Typescript, REST, docker, PostgreSQL, RabbitMQ. Clickhouse, redis.

Projects

Can’t find the needed talent?

 
Tekla get in touch banner
bottom of page